Industrial roof replacement services involve removing and replacing an aging or damaged roof on commercial or industrial properties.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roof, removing the old roofing materials, and installing new, durable roofing systems designed to withstand the specific demands of industrial environments. Service providers focus on ensuring the new roof provides long-lasting protection, improves energy efficiency, and meets the structural needs of the building. These projects often require specialized techniques and materials to handle large surface areas and the unique requirements of industrial facilities.
This service helps address a variety of common problems that can compromise a roof’s integrity. Over time, roofs may develop leaks, cracks, or holes due to weather exposure, age, or poor initial installation. These issues can lead to water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ration if not addressed promptly. Industrial roof replacement is a practical solution for buildings experiencing frequent leaks, significant wear and tear, or outdated roofing systems that no longer provide adequate protection. Replacing an aging roof can prevent costly repairs down the line and restore the building’s safety and functionality.
Properties that typically require industrial roof replacement include warehouses, manufacturing plants, distribution centers, and large commercial facilities. These structures often have expansive roof surfaces that are exposed to harsh weather conditions, making regular maintenance insufficient over time. Business owners or property managers may consider a roof replacement when signs of deterioration become visible, such as sagging, blistering, or persistent leaks. An upgraded roof can improve energy efficiency, reduce maintenance costs, and enhance the overall value of the property.

The overview below groups typical Industrial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Thomasville,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of repairs or patching in Thomasville, GA,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Partial Replacement - For replacing sections of an industrial roof, local contractors typically charge between $3,000 and $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$10,000+, though fewer projects tend to fall into this higher tier.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of an industrial roof usually costs between $15,000 and $50,000 in Thomasville, with larger or more intricate jobs potentially exceeding this range. Most full replacements are in the middle to upper part of this spectrum.
High-End or Complex Projects - Large, highly customized or multi-faceted roof replacements can surpass $50,000, but these are less common. Local service providers can help determine specific costs based on project details and sc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that an industrial ro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ive roof surface damage, visible sagging, and the presence of mold or mildew indicating moisture intrusion.
How do I choose the right contractor for industrial roof replacement? It’s important to consider experience with similar projects, local reputation, and the ability to provide quality materials and workmanship.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for industrial buildings? Common options include built-up roofing (BUR), single-ply membranes like EPDM or TPO, and metal roofing systems, depending on the building’s needs.
Are there specific maintenance practices to prolong the life of a new industrial roof? Regular inspections, prompt repairs of minor damages, and keeping the roof surface clear of debris can help extend its service life.
What should I expect during an industrial roof replacement project? The process typically involves site assessment, removal of the existing roof, installation of new materials, and final inspection by the contractor.
